重庆华为云代理商:安卓Studio访问MySQL数据库
介绍
在当今移动应用开发领域,安卓平台是最受欢迎的之一。而为了支持这些应用的数据存储和管理,MySQL数据库是一个常用的选择。本文将探讨如何通过重庆华为云代理商的服务,利用安卓Studio访问MySQL数据库,并体现出华为云的优势。
华为云的优势
作为全球领先的云服务提供商之一,华为云拥有丰富的云计算资源和强大的技术支持,为开发者提供了稳定、高效的云服务。
- 高可用性:华为云采用分布式架构和负载均衡技术,保证了数据库服务的高可用性,能够有效应对突发的访问量。
- 安全性:华为云提供多重安全防护机制,包括网络隔离、数据加密等,保障用户数据的安全。
- 灵活性:华为云的服务支持多种开发语言和平台,开发者可以根据自己的需求选择合适的技术栈。
- 成本效益:华为云提供按需计费的服务模式,开发者可以根据实际使用情况灵活调整资源,降低成本。
使用安卓Studio访问MySQL数据库
在安卓应用中使用MySQL数据库,需要进行以下步骤:
- 导入MySQL驱动:在项目的build.gradle文件中添加MySQL驱动的依赖。
- 建立数据库连接:在应用中使用JDBC建立与MySQL数据库的连接,并进行身份验证。
- 执行SQL操作:通过连接对象执行SQL语句,进行数据库的增删改查操作。
示例代码
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.ResultSet;
import java.sql.Statement;
public class MySQLHelper {
public static void main(String[] args) {
try {
// 加载MySQL驱动
Class.forName("com.mysql.jdbc.Driver");
// 建立数据库连接
Connection conn = DriverManager.getConnection("jdbc:mysql://localhost:3306/mydatabase", "username", "password");
// 创建Statement对象
Statement stmt = conn.createStatement();
// 执行SQL查询
ResultSet rs = stmt.executeQuery("SELECT * FROM mytable");
// 遍历结果集
while (rs.next()) {
// 处理查询结果
System.out.println(rs.getString("column1") + " " + rs.getString("column2"));
}
// 关闭连接
conn.close();
} catch (Exception e) {
e.printStackTrace();
}
}
}
总结
通过重庆华为云代理商的服务,结合安卓Studio访问MySQL数据库,开发者可以充分利用华为云的优势,如高可用性、安全性、灵活性和成本效益,为安卓应用提供稳定、高效的数据存储和管理解决方案。
```